Research interests: Symmetric key cryptography, Algebraic cryptanalysis, Boolean functions.
The domain can be extended to Coding theory, Complexity theory and Discrete mathematics.

Teaching: Information and Coding Theory(M464),
(6th and 8th semester of undergraduate course at NISER).


PhD degree: Computer Science (Cryptography) from Indian Statistical Institute, Kolkata in 2006.
PhD thesis: On Some Necessary Conditions of Boolean Functions to Resist Algebraic Attacks [pdf].

Master degrees:
MTech (Computer Science) from Indian Statistical Institute, Kolkata in 2003,
MSc (Mathematics) from Utkal University, Bhubaneswar, India in 2001.
